IT'S FAN APPRECIATION NIGHT!
FRIDAY, APRIL 13 7:30PM
STING VS CALGARY ROUGHNECKS
JOBING.COM ARENA



It's the final regular season home game for your Arizona Sting as they battle for a home game in the NLL Champions' Cup Playoffs! This game is all about you--the Sting fan--so we'll be giving away hundreds of great prizes throughout the game like a Sony Playstation 3, US Airways gift cards, an HDTV, and much more! The first 5,000 fans in the arena will receive a Sting Rally Flag to help cheer on the Sting against Calgary!

If you can't make it to the arena, be sure to tune in to the Sting on television on Cox 7 or online with B2 Networks!

DETAILS OF STING PLAYOFF GAME ANNOUNCED

The date and time of the NLL West Division Semifinal match between the Arizona Sting and Calgary Roughnecks were announced by the National Lacrosse League yesterday. The game will take place on Saturday, April 21, at 7:30pm MST/6:30pm PST at the Pengrowth Saddledome in Calgary, Alberta.
Saturday’s game will be broadcast online by B2 Networks. Fans can catch the action live by logging onto www.b2live.com.

The Sting have played the Roughnecks once before in the post-season, defeating the then-defending league champions on their home floor in the 2005 West Division Championship by a score of 19-15.
